Topic: Butterflies. The class needs a new mascot for its soccer team. Phoebe suggests butterflies, but everyone thinks they're wimpy--until the Friz flutters in. Topic: Butterflies. About: butterflies that look like moths

Story: No story just Janet running around and the children stranded as tiny people.

Production: butterflyly dull

Character Focus: Phoebe and Janet. It's sad Janet has had more focus episodes than Tim.

Subject Fact or fictional: Fact but they didn't teach much.

Child Endangermeant level: 300. Not sure where they are located but they drove to a swamp which had crocodiles. Then the children were trapped as tiny people for the whole episode. Ms. Friz did not have a back up plan.

Should you watch this?: No. Nothing was taught. They spent an episode watching Janet chase butterflies like an idiot.

However I must say. As dull as the episode was I'm surprised they didn't catch a dullerfly.

Magic offers a return to mystery and enchantment, providing individuals with a sense of awe and wonder that may be missing in their everyday lives. The popularity of fantasy novels, movies, and television shows featuring magic has also played a role in the resurgence. These forms of media often depict magic as a powerful and transformative force, captivating audiences and fueling their interest in exploring magical practices themselves. The success of franchises such as Harry Potter and Game of Thrones has undoubtedly contributed to the reemergence of magic in popular culture. Furthermore, the widespread accessibility of information through the internet has allowed individuals to explore and learn about magic more easily. Online communities and forums dedicated to magic have created a sense of community and support for those interested in practicing magic. This interconnectedness has fostered the growth of new practitioners and increased interest in magical practices. It is important to note that the resurgence of magic does not necessarily imply a literal belief in supernatural powers. Many individuals engage with magic as a form of self-expression, personal development, or spiritual exploration. They may incorporate magical rituals or practices into their lives as a means of connecting with themselves, others, or the natural world. In conclusion, the return of magic in society can be attributed to a variety of factors, including the desire for escapism, the appeal of mystery and wonder, the influence of popular culture, and the accessibility of information. Regardless of the reasons, the resurgence of magic reflects a human fascination with the unknown and our innate desire to explore and understand the world beyond what can be explained rationally..
